| Grantseeking Basics With An Introduction to the Foundation Center Website-2010 |
Learn how the Grant Center’s resources can help you become a more effective grantseeker! An introductory session geared to beginners, provides instruction in foundation research and identifying potential funders. Includes a tour of the Grant Center and an introduction to the Foundation Center’s website.

| Introduction to the Foundation Directory Online -2010 |
This hour-long session provides a hands-on introduction to the Foundation Center’s web subscription database, The Foundation Directory Online Professional. In this program, you will learn how to create customized searches to develop targeted lists of foundations that will match your organization’s funding needs and search grants made by top funders.

Proposal Writing Basics - 2010
|
This program is an introductory overview of the proposal writing process. It will provide the basics of writing a proposal for your nonprofit organization, designed for new proposal writers or for those requiring a refresher. Covered will be the key components of a proposal and signing and packaging the proposal. Suggestions on contacting the funder if turned down are provided. Also included is information on finding more information on proposal writing, including sample proposals.

| Finding Foundation Support For Your Education -2010 |
An hour long, hands on class on obtaining financial support for your studies. A demonstration on the use of Foundation Grants to Individuals Online will show you how to quickly search through detailed descriptions of more than 6,000 foundation programs that fund students, artists, researchers and other individual grantseekers. You’ll learn to find accurate, up-to-date information on foundations that fund: educational support scholarships, fellowships, loans, internships, students and graduates of specific schools, arts and cultural support, awards, prizes and grants by nomination, international applicants, employees/families of employees at specific companies, research and professional support and general welfare and special needs.

| Fundraising in a Challenging Economy - 2010 |
Intended for representatives of nonprofit organizations engaged in fundraising, this new class will give you a basic overview of what you can do to survive and succeed in sustaining your nonprofit during the current economic crisis. We’ll cover what you can do to ensure your organization is positioned to weather the current economic situation. We’ll talk about how to adapt your fundraising strategy in the current economy. Included will be links and resources to help you determine approaches that best fit with your nonprofit’s situation.

| Introduction to Fundraising Planning -2010 |
If your organization has never developed a fundraising plan or calendar, this hour-long session is for you. The program will show you how to analyze your own organization’s situation and develop a fundraising plan. You’ll learn how to conduct an assets inventory, develop a case statement, identify fundraising partners and prepare a fundraising plan and calendar.
